The other day at work I tried using a small accelerometer 
as a contact mic.  The charge amp gain is set by a pot 
that sounds like this style.  Anyway, I noticed that when 
I adjusted it I heard a little zzz...zzz...zzz on the output.  
Makes sense that you would hear the wiper going across 
the little wires, but I would not have thought of it.  

I don't know if the ones you mention are wirewound.
Having the multi-turn dial would be great for noting 
precise settings.  CV gain, CV offset, tuning...
Maybe not in the audio path though.
